A vision of providing the best medical care to the community in Fort Worth was germinating in 1915 when several Fort Worth doctors got together to discuss this very subject. With great foresight, they determined that a group of doctors, rather than individually, would be able to provide better all-around medical care to their patients.

In 1916, Dr. Heb Beall formed The Fort Worth Clinic along with Dr. Frank Cook Beall and Dr. John H. Sewell. All the original partners were from Johns Hopkins. Though they registered the name “The Fort Worth Clinic” with the Tarrant County Courthouse, they continued to function as the Beall Clinic.

Early discussion and development of the group resulted in the "Free Babies Hospital". Further initiatives with a patient and his wife, W.I. and Matilda Cook, resulted in the formation of the Cook Children's Medical Center as it is known today.

Then over 50 years ago in 1952 “The Fort Worth Clinic” was founded, and since that time has continued to provide competent professional and caring healthcare services to Fort Worth-area residents. Today, our primary focus remains meeting our patients’ needs.
